I am a versatile software engineer with over 4 years of experience developing complex object-oriented programs based on platforms ranging from desktop, client/server, web apps, to RESTful APIs. I have coded in many languages. I’ve done plenty of database work in SQL.Exceptional Problem Solver, able to analyze code and engineer wellresearched solutions. Adapts quickly, superior capacity of understanding new concepts and applying them correctly.
· Development of server side features using Java based frameworks like Springboot, Maven, etc.
Developing applications which can be run as offline jobs using cloud based services like AWS batch jobs and also work with distributed stream processing computation frameworks like Apache Storm and Spark.
Deploying applications using docker and kubernetes on AWS hosted environments.
· Following Agile based best practices for any development stories.
· Automating end to end testing on a spring based framework by building tools which are capable of validating Splunk logs and db records.
· Enhancement of CICD Pipelines using frameworks ArgoCD, Jenkins , Blueocean, etc.